E-commerce platformsConnect with an API key

Shopify voice AI integration

The Shopify integration connects your AI voice and chat agents to Shopify, so they can look up an order on a live call. It's a e-commerce platforms connector that runs as a tool the agent calls mid-conversation — you connect with an api key, attach it to an agent, and it acts in real time without a human in the loop.

Shopify API docs

Last updated 2026-06-27

What your agent can do with Shopify

Look up an orderLook up an order

Find a Shopify order by its number to answer questions about status, payment, items or delivery. Pass digits only.

Inputs

FieldTypeDescription
order_number*stringOrder number, digits only (e.g. 1001).
Look up a customerLook up a customer

Find a Shopify customer by phone, email or name — use to recognise the caller and see their order history (orders_count, total_spent, last order).

Inputs

FieldTypeDescription
query*stringPhone with country code, email, or name to search for.
Search productsSearch products

Search the Shopify catalogue by name/keywords. Returns matching products with their variants, price and stock so the agent can answer availability and pricing.

Inputs

FieldTypeDescription
query*stringProduct name or keywords to search for.
Create a checkout linkCreate a checkout link

Create a Shopify draft order and return its invoice_url — a ready-to-pay checkout link to read out or send over WhatsApp/SMS (abandoned-cart recovery, phone orders). Pass line items as title/price/quantity.

Inputs

FieldTypeDescription
customer_emailstringCustomer email, if known.
line_items*arrayItems for the checkout. Each: {title, price (store currency, string), quantity}.
notestringOptional note for the order.
Update an orderUpdate an order

Tag a Shopify order and/or add a note — e.g. tag a cash-on-delivery order COD Confirmed after the caller confirms, or note the outcome. Use the numeric order id from order.lookup.

Inputs

FieldTypeDescription
notestringNote to add to the order.
order_id*integerNumeric Shopify order id (the id field from order.lookup).
tagsstringComma-separated tags to set, e.g. COD Confirmed.

What you'll need to connect Shopify

Connect with an API key. In Telenow, open Integrations → Shopify and provide:

  • Admin API access token — Shopify admin > Settings > Apps and sales channels > Develop apps > your app > Admin API access token (starts with shpat_). Needs read_orders, write_orders, read_products, read_customers.
  • Store domain — Your permanent myshopify.com domain, e.g. mystore.myshopify.com (no https://, not a custom storefront domain). The outbound URL is SSRF-checked at dispatch.
  • Store

Other E-commerce platforms integrations

Frequently asked questions

What can an AI voice agent do with Shopify?

During a live call or chat, a Telenow agent can look up an order, look up a customer, search products, create a checkout link, and update an order — each runs as a tool the agent calls mid-conversation, so it acts on Shopify in real time without a human.

How do you connect Shopify to Telenow?

In Telenow, open Integrations, pick Shopify, and you paste a Shopify API key into the connection, then bind it to your agent. Then add its e-commerce platforms tool to your agent (or install a template that already includes it) and you're live.

Can I use Shopify in a ready-made agent?

Yes — add Shopify to any Telenow agent, or start from a template and attach it as a tool.

Does Shopify work on phone calls and WhatsApp?

Yes. Telenow agents run on phone, web, chat and WhatsApp, and Shopify works the same across every channel — the agent calls it whenever the conversation needs it.

How much does the Shopify integration cost?

Connecting Shopify is included — you only pay Telenow's transparent per-minute and per-component usage, and new accounts get free signup credit to try it.

₹300.00 free credit on signup

Connect Shopify to your AI voice agent

Sign up free and get ₹300.00 in credit — no card required. Connect your number, pick a template, and go live in minutes.